Abstract

Official abstract text for this publication.

The purpose of the present invention is to provide a stainless steel member and a production method thereof, said stainless steel member having a passivation layer formed on a surface of a base material formed from stainless steel, wherein the film thickness of the passivation layer is 2-20 nm, and the concentration of chromium atoms in the outermost surface of the passivation layer is 0.1-2.3 by atomic percentage. Also provided are a device or container, the liquid-contact part of which in contact with a semiconductor treatment liquid is formed from the stainless steel member, a semiconductor treatment liquid production method for producing the semiconductor treatment liquid by using the device, and a semiconductor treatment liquid storage method for storing the semiconductor treatment liquid in the container.

First claim

Opening claim text (preview).

1 . An austenite stainless steel member comprising: a base material made of austenite stainless steel; and a passivation layer formed on a surface of the base material made of austenite stainless steel, wherein the passivation layer has a thickness of 2 nm to 20 nm, a concentration of chromium atoms in an outermost surface of the passivation layer is 0.1 atomic % to 1.0 atomic %, and a concentration of silicon atoms in the outermost surface of the passivation layer is 2 atomic % to 10 atomic %. 2 . The austenite stainless steel member according to claim 1 which is for use in a part to be in contact with a semiconductor treatment liquid. 3 . (canceled) 4 . The austenite stainless steel member according to claim 1 , wherein the passivation layer has a thickness of 3 nm to 20 nm. 5 . An apparatus having a part to be in contact with a semiconductor treatment liquid, wherein the part comprises the austenite stainless steel member according to claim 1 . 6 . A method of producing a semiconductor treatment liquid, the method comprising: using the apparatus according to claim 5 in producing a semiconductor treatment liquid. 7 . A method of storing a semiconductor treatment liquid, the method comprising: storing the semiconductor treatment liquid in a container comprising the austenite stainless steel member according to claim 1 . 8 . A method of producing the austenite stainless steel member according to claim 1 , the method comprising: forming the passivation layer by electropolishing, rinsing with inorganic acid, and heating, wherein the heating is performed at a temperature of 300° C. to 450° C. in an oxidizing atmosphere. 9 . (canceled) 10 . The apparatus according to claim 5 , which is a reaction tank, distillation column, stirrer, transport pipe, or storage tank for use in a semiconductor treatment liquid producing process. 11 . A container having a part to be in contact with a semiconductor treatment liquid, wherein the part comprises the austenite stainless steel member according to claim 1 .
